Western Digital's new Raptor at $2 a Gig

January 04, 2006 at 04:43 PM in Hardware

wdfEnterprise_SATA_ADFD.jpg
Western Digital has unveiled its latest Raptor drive. 10,000 RPM, SATA connectivity and $2 a gig? That's a bit expensive for my taste but as with most things, these drives are going to start out expensive and slowly work their way down to affordable. I mean who wouldn't like a 150 Gig drive that spins at 10,000 RPM and has a SATA connection? I know I would but at this point I don't have the $300 to drop on it. If you do have the jing for this thing, you probably can't find a faster drive (except maybe for SCSI) at that capacity. Check the specs at WD's website.
